1.一种页面显示方法,其特征在于,所述页面包含N个子页面,N个子页面包含相同内容行、且相邻子页面之间的高度差为M个内容行,N个子页面的内容相同,M大于等于1,N大于等于2;在将内容加载到子页面的过程中,自动布局为多个内容行,当一个子内容在一个内容行中放不下时,自动放置到下一个内容行;该方法包括:当沿着指定方向执行页面切换时,确定目标显示窗口当前显示的第一子页面中的第L1个内容行;
依据所述指定方向并按照设定的移动策略移动N个子页面,以使移动至目标显示窗口所在页面位置的第二子页面在所述目标显示窗口显示第L2个内容行,所述第L2个内容行依据所述高度差和所述第L1个内容行确定。
2.如权利要求1所述的页面显示方法,其特征在于,相邻页面位置的子页面中位于右侧的子页面比位于左侧的子页面高M个内容行;
所述依据所述指定方向并按照设定的移动策略移动N个子页面,包括:针对每一子页面,检查该子页面是否为所述指定方向上最后一个子页面;
如果否,将所述子页面移动至所述指定方向上且与该子页面相邻的邻居子页面所处的第一页面位置;
如果是,将该子页面移动至所述指定方向的相反方向上的最后一个子页面所处的第二页面位置。
3.如权利要求1或2所述的页面显示方法,其特征在于,
在依据所述指定方向并按照设定的移动策略移动N个子页面之前,进一步包括:当所述指定方向为朝着所述目标显示窗口的左侧方向时,检查所述L1是否大于所述第一子页面中所有内容行的总行数与所述M之差,如果否,继续执行依据所述指定方向并按照设定的移动策略移动N个子页面的步骤;
当所述指定方向为朝着所述目标显示窗口的右侧方向时,检查所述L1是否小于或等于所述M,如果否,继续执行依据所述指定方向并按照设定的移动策略移动N个子页面的步骤。
4.如权利要求1或2所述的页面显示方法,其特征在于,
所述指定方向为朝着所述目标显示窗口的左侧方向;
所述L1小于或等于所述第一子页面中所有内容行的总行数与所述M之差时,所述L2为所述L1与所述M之和;所述L1大于所述第一子页面中所有内容行的总行数与所述M之差时,所述L2为所述L1与第一子页面中所有内容行的总行数的差与所述M之和;
或者,
所述指定方向为朝着所述目标显示窗口的右侧方向;
所述L1大于所述M时,所述L2为所述L1与所述M之差;所述L1小于或等于所述M时,所述L2为所述第一子页面中所有内容行的总行数与所述L1的和与所述M之差。
5.一种页面显示装置,其特征在于,所述页面包含N个子页面,N个子页面包含相同内容行、且相邻子页面之间的高度差为M个内容行,N个子页面的内容相同,M大于等于1,N大于等于2;在将内容加载到子页面的过程中,自动布局为多个内容行,当一个子内容在一个内容行中放不下时,自动放置到下一个内容行;该装置包括:当前显示内容行确定模块,用于当沿着指定方向执行页面切换时,确定目标显示窗口当前显示的第一子页面中的第L1个内容行;
子页面移动模块,用于依据所述指定方向并按照设定的移动策略移动N个子页面,以使移动至目标显示窗口所在页面位置的第二子页面在所述目标显示窗口显示第L2个内容行,所述第L2个内容行依据所述高度差和所述第L1个内容行确定。
6.如权利要求5所述的页面显示装置,其特征在于,
相邻页面位置的子页面中位于右侧的子页面比位于左侧的子页面高M个内容行;所述子页面移动模块依据所述指定方向并按照设定的移动策略移动N个子页面时,具体用于:针对每一子页面,检查该子页面是否为所述指定方向上最后一个子页面;
如果否,将所述子页面移动至所述指定方向上且与该子页面相邻的邻居子页面所处的第一页面位置;
如果是,将该子页面移动至所述指定方向的相反方向上的最后一个子页面所处的第二页面位置。
7.如权利要求5或6所述的页面显示装置,其特征在于,
所述子页面移动模块在依据所述指定方向并按照设定的移动策略移动N个子页面之前,进一步用于:当所述指定方向为朝着所述目标显示窗口的左侧方向时,检查所述L1是否大于所述第一子页面中所有内容行的总行数与所述M之差,如果否,继续执行依据所述指定方向并按照设定的移动策略移动N个子页面的步骤;
当所述指定方向为朝着所述目标显示窗口的右侧方向时,检查所述L1是否小于或等于所述M,如果否,继续执行依据所述指定方向并按照设定的移动策略移动N个子页面的步骤。
8.如权利要求5或6所述的页面显示装置,其特征在于,
所述指定方向为朝着所述目标显示窗口的左侧方向;
所述L1小于或等于所述第一子页面中所有内容行的总行数与所述M之差时,所述L2为所述L1与所述M之和;所述L1大于所述第一子页面中所有内容行的总行数与所述M之差时,所述L2为所述L1与第一子页面中所有内容行的总行数的差与所述M之和;
或者,
所述指定方向为朝着所述目标显示窗口的右侧方向;
所述L1大于所述M时,所述L2为所述L1与所述M之差;所述L1小于或等于所述M时,所述L2为所述第一子页面中所有内容行的总行数与所述L1的和与所述M之差。
9.一种电子设备,其特征在于,包括处理器及存储器;所述存储器存储有可被处理器调用的程序;其中,所述处理器执行所述程序时,实现如权利要求1‑4中任意一项所述的页面显示方法。
10.一种机器可读存储介质,其特征在于,其上存储有程序,该程序被处理器执行时,实现如权利要求1‑4中任意一项所述的页面显示方法。